The story is the same, but the best way to play depends on how much setup you want and whether you need a portable local copy.
Choose the browser build for the quickest start
The HTML5 version is the simplest option for a first look: open the game, allow the page to load, and begin without installing an archive. It is also useful when you are playing on a shared machine and do not want to keep game files.
Browser storage can be cleared by privacy tools or browser resets, so it is not the best place for a save you cannot afford to lose.
Choose a download for a persistent local copy
Windows, macOS, Linux, and Android packages are listed for version 0.2. A local build avoids browser-storage limits and is usually the more comfortable option for repeated playthroughs.
- Match the package to your operating system.
- Extract desktop archives before launching the game.
- Back up saves before replacing an older build.
Why the source matters
Use the developer's itch.io listing rather than a repost or a repackaged installer. The developer identifies that listing as the official distribution page and asks players not to use reuploaded copies.
If something goes wrong
First confirm the build number and platform. For browser problems, try a current Chrome- or Edge-family browser and disable aggressive page translation for the game tab. For a desktop archive, extract it fully and keep the application with its bundled files.
